Utah Hispanic Two Or More Races Male or Men Population By County in 2019
Based on the US Census Vintage data estimates, in 2019, the Utah Hispanic Two Or More Races male population was 8,199; and represented 0.51% of the total Utah male population in 2019.
Salt Lake County had the highest number of Hispanic Two Or More Races male population (3,447), followed by Utah County (1,368), and Davis County (881).
On the other hand, Wayne County had the lowest Hispanic Two Or More Races male population (1), followed by Rich County (2), and Daggett County (2).

| County | Male Population | % of County Male Population |
|---|---|---|
| Beaver | 16 | 0.47 |
| Box Elder | 151 | 0.53 |
| Cache | 319 | 0.50 |
| Carbon | 66 | 0.65 |
| Daggett | 2 | 0.37 |
| Davis | 881 | 0.49 |
| Duchesne | 46 | 0.46 |
| Emery | 10 | 0.20 |
| Garfield | 9 | 0.34 |
| Grand | 25 | 0.52 |
| Iron | 112 | 0.41 |
| Juab | 19 | 0.31 |
| Kane | 11 | 0.28 |
| Millard | 29 | 0.43 |
| Morgan | 15 | 0.24 |
| Piute | 6 | 0.80 |
| Rich | 2 | 0.16 |
| Salt Lake | 3447 | 0.59 |
| San Juan | 14 | 0.18 |
| Sanpete | 75 | 0.46 |
| Sevier | 20 | 0.18 |
| Summit | 56 | 0.26 |
| Tooele | 176 | 0.48 |
| Uintah | 79 | 0.44 |
| Utah | 1368 | 0.43 |
| Wasatch | 83 | 0.48 |
| Washington | 336 | 0.38 |
| Wayne | 1 | 0.07 |
| Weber | 825 | 0.63 |
